#10d691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10d691 is composed of 6.3% red, 83.9%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 159.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 45.1%. #10d691 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#00ad23.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#10d691 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10d691 has RGB values of R:16, G:214,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 1103505.

Shades and Tints of #10d691
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d09 is the darkest color, while #fafff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#10d691
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717574 is the less saturated color, while #07df94 is the most saturated one.
